Tips for Starting a Ev Vs Gas Business in Pennsylvania

  • EV inventory allocation from manufacturers is tied to your state's ZEV mandate status. Dealers in ZEV states get more inventory. Period.
  • Charging infrastructure in your area determines EV demand. Check PlugShare for the local charging density before stocking inventory.
  • Used EV margins are volatile. Battery degradation concerns suppress resale values unpredictably. Factor in extended warranty costs.
  • Service revenue per EV is 30-40% lower than gas vehicles. Fewer parts, fewer oil changes. Your service department model needs adjusting.
